I have assigned categories to some of my calendar entries and would like to
know if it is possible to apply some type of filter to only show entries assigned a particular category. Thank you. |

Yes - you can Define a View that is filtered. Turn on the Advanced Toolbar
and while in the Calendar, use the Current View Window to select Define View (this depends a bit on your version which you forgot to mention). I hope this helps you at least a little bit!
